Making Sense of Sustainability 2011 / 2012 Report

the continuing commitment by businesses to behave ethically and contribute to economic development while improving the quality of life of the workplace as well as the local community and society at large; a company's obligation to be accountable to all of its stakeholders in all its operations and activities (including financial stakeholders as well as suppliers, customers, and employees) with the aim of achieving sustainable development not only in the economic dimension but also in the social and environmental dimensions

FOR Our Clients


RPM Building Solutions Group

Multi-phase, global engagement to align business unit sustainability practices with a corporate vision

Project Impacts and Outcomes
  • Defined bold,10-year goals and one-year targets
  • Designed tracking and reporting methodology
  • Designed structure to align with organizational culture
  • More than $1 million operating savings identified
  • Deeper engagement and understanding of sustainability throughout the organization

Share This

In Words

Make Sense of Sustainability with Our Updated Glossary

Don’t know the difference between a Proxy Statement and a Sustainability Report? Need help understanding sustainability lingo? Let BrownFlynn make sense of sustainability with our updated glossary.

Read More

Our Clients


Lubrizol engaged BrownFlynn to set the strategic direction of the organization and improve its sustainability reporting activities, including its supplier network using the CDP.

Read More